Output 781660ae82135c97cc559f1c57c286525aaeb966837f9c7b91bd269686b266f9:0

value
937981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b6a512d258d87781c1b48fa7e2ab8afbefc2fde OP_EQUAL
address
3EQBDFRRS4CW1P2in8mxxtAAfvzFHHyBmM
transaction
781660ae82135c97cc559f1c57c286525aaeb966837f9c7b91bd269686b266f9
spent
true